How AI NSFW Impact Content Moderation
In today’s digital landscape, AI-based NSFW systems are increasingly essential for moderating vast amounts of user-generated content. Platforms are overwhelmed by the volume of content, making manual moderation inefficient. AI NSFW technologies automate detection of adult content rapidly, speeding up review processes.
AI NSFW relies on sophisticated algorithms that scrutinize visual and textual data to distinguish safe from explicit content. They achieve high accuracy by retraining on fresh datasets.
The technology struggles with certain nuances. What is explicit in one culture may be acceptable in another. Errors in filtering can impact users unfairly. Therefore, hybrid approaches combining AI with human oversight are often recommended.
Platforms using AI NSFW often implement tiered systems. Starting with AI-based scanning, content flagged for review moves to human teams. It balances automation with human intelligence.
Practical Implementations of AI NSFW
AI NSFW finds application in various online services and digital sectors. Some major application areas include:The top uses include:
- Social media platforms: to control explicit user content.
- Online marketplaces: ensuring product images comply with content guidelines.
- Streaming services: filtering live broadcasts.
- Content creation: restricting inappropriate AI-generated imagery.
- Corporate environments: enforcing corporate browsing policies.
Some systems lever AI to notify guardians or administrators upon detection of NSFW material. Filtering mechanisms often safeguard younger demographics by restricting inappropriate access.

Ethical and Legal Considerations in AI NSFW
Using AI to handle NSFW content demands careful ethical consideration. Issues such as consent, privacy, algorithmic bias, and free speech are prominent. Bias in training data can lead to disproportionate censorship or overlook harmful content.
Lawmakers are increasingly focused on governing AI-driven content moderation. Complying with local regulations demands adaptable AI filtering systems. Companies must balance adherence to laws with user rights and freedom of expression.
